A quick definition of fidelitatis sacramentum:

Term: FIDELITATIS SACRAMENTUM

Definition: Fidelitatis sacramentum was an oath that a person called a vassal had to take to show loyalty to their lord. It was a promise to serve and protect their lord in exchange for land or other benefits.

A more thorough explanation:

Definition: Fidelitatis sacramentum was an oath of loyalty that a vassal had to take to their lord in medieval times.

Example: When a knight was granted land by a lord, they had to swear an oath of fealty to the lord. This oath was called fidelitatis sacramentum.

Explanation: The example illustrates how fidelitatis sacramentum was an important part of the feudal system. The oath of loyalty ensured that the vassal would serve their lord faithfully and protect their land. In return, the lord would provide protection and support to the vassal.
